An analysis of the relationship of input metrics
Abstract: Input metrics evaluate the progress of testing in terms of features of inputs present in a test suite. Previous works, as early as the 1950s, established a number of such metrics, but few endeavored to compare them. This paper does so by utilizing existing methods proposed for other metric classes in partition testing literature. After defining and reviewing common input metrics, we begin with a short case study revealing that typical empirical comparison strategies are fundamentally insufficient for comparing metrics. Then, we demonstrate how one rigorously improves a standard metric by defining and implementing -alt-path, a new metric which reduces redundancy while improving sensitivity over -path. Each of the other common input metrics are then systematically compared before discussing the implications of our findings. With these contributions, we bring forward partition testing analysis methods that justify and form a strategy for future research in refining input metrics.
